Rate-parity checker (Tariffscope) flaked on Merrow CI all week: upstream mock hotel feed returns gzip without header, parser chokes, job marked red. Patched the fixture loader to sniff compression; reran the full matrix green. No prod impact, parity alerts were paused during the window. For anyone auditing the runs, the passing build is identified by the token below.

trace token, kahog-tajeg: htk6_97d963

# Autocomplete index for the Marrowfield search service.
# The index rebuild has been slow since the Pellindrome dataset grew past
# 40M rows; nightly rebuilds now take ~3 hours. We shard by prefix and
# skip terms under three characters to keep things tolerable. If rebuilds
# start overlapping the morning traffic window, lower the batch size here
# rather than the worker count. The indexer pulls rows from the database
# configured on the next line.

replica DSN, yahaf-yagaf: mongodb://tamath_svc:a2netSk3RZMuTj@db-d084.novacsoft.internal:5432/ralmir

ShrinkRay CLI — Environment Variables. The batch resizer reads its config from a .env file in the working directory. SHRINK_THREADS controls parallelism; SHRINK_FORMAT sets the output type. Support should verify both are present before debugging slow jobs on the Dunmore render boxes. The upload token used for cloud output must appear on the following line.

sealed setting: VAULT_KEY20=c8ea1e419912889df6b4